2024 ACAC Men's Futsal Players of the Year

2024 ACAC Men's Futsal Players of the Year

Edmonton, AB (March 9, 2024) – 

North Male Player of the Year | Cleisson Anklam | Keyaon Huskies:

The Alberta Colleges Athletic Conference (ACAC) is pleased to announce Cleisson Anklam of the Keyano College Huskies has been selected as the 2023-24 ACAC Men's Futsal North Division Player of the Year.  

Anklam led the way for the Men's Futsal Huskies, who went 10-0-0 in the 2024 regular season, outscoring their  opponents 37-18. He scored seven of his team's 37 goals in the regular season, including a two-goal performance in a 4-2 win against the Portage College Voyageurs on February 3, 2024.  

"That was long overdue," Head Coach Niels Slotboom said. "Clearly one of the top players in the country, not just in Alberta; not just in futsal, but soccer as well. It's nice to see the recognition of what he can do and how important he is to our program."

"All the props to him, he puts it together every single game now. I'm excited to see what this will do for his confidence and what that'll look like in soccer next year."  

Anklam, a product of São Luiz Gonzaga, Brazil, is currently studying Business Administration and has provided a leading presence to the Men's Soccer/Futsal program. He helped lead the Huskies to Gold on the Futsal court in 2023 and was a core piece in the Huskies' Championship run during the 2023 outdoor soccer season that saw  them place fourth in the entire country. He was recognized as a member of the ACAC Men's Soccer North Division All-Conference team for the 2023 outdoor season. Within the Huskies' program, Anklam was honoured as the  Men's Futsal Player of the Year at their annual awards in spring 2023.  

This prestigious award will be recognized at the 2024 ACAC Men's Futsal Championship hosted by Portage College in Lac La Biche, AB. 


South Male Player of the Year | Pedro Noschang | Olds Broncos:

The Alberta Colleges Athletic Conference (ACAC) is pleased to announce Pedro Noschang of the Olds College Broncos has been selected as the 2023-24 ACAC South Men's Futsal Player of the Year, becoming the inaugural winner of the award. 

Noschang was an instrumental piece all over the court for the Broncos, scoring eight goals in nine matches spanning the two ACAC South Regional competitions while also maintaining a high standard of defensive play throughout the winter.

"Pedro is not only a talented student-athlete, he is also a great ambassador and representative of Broncos Athletics," said Trina Radcliffe, Athletics Manager at Olds College of Agriculture & Technology. "I am happy to see his dedication and commitment recognized with this award."

In his second season of eligibility with the Broncos, the Novo Hamburgo, BRA product is enrolled in the Business Management program at Olds College of Agriculture & Technology.

This prestigious award will be recognized at the 2024 ACAC Men's Futsal Championship hosted by Portage College in Lac La Biche, Alta.

About the ACAC: The ACAC is the governing body for intercollegiate athletics in Alberta. Its mission is to provide competitive collegiate sport experiences, promote academic achievement and be a leader of sport development in Canada.
